A rubber ball contains 5.70*10⁻¹ dm³ of gas at a pressure of 1.05 atm. What volume will the gas occupy at 7.47 atm?

Assuming ideal gas behavior:

P1V1 = P2V2

V2 = P1V1/P2 = 1.05 atm * 0.570 liters / 7.47 atm = 0.080 liters
